The Renegades and Their Collection of Carnies The Renegades and Their Collection of Carnies are the Houston, TX based visual and performance art troupe co-founded by Jessie, Luna and ms. YET. Their pieces combine visual art, inventive costuming and belly dance into their original shows. Using the language of belly dance to present their eclectic vision of performance, the Renegades embody artistic expression through movement. Y. E. Curated by Y. E. Torres, A Moving Theater of Absolute Uniqueness one-night event which seeks to encourage unconventional performance that is influenced by contemporary belly dance. The event intersects discipline-defying, breakthrough projects which challenge conventional ideas about movement, costume, installation and its application in performance.  A Moving Theater of Absolute Uniqueness will serve as an outlet for experimentation by creating an environment for artistic growth and expanding public access to non-traditional dance in Houston, Texas.
